iShares Latin America 40 ETF

124 hedge funds and large institutions have $343M invested in iShares Latin America 40 ETF in 2013 Q4 according to their latest regulatory filings, with 18 funds opening new positions, 28 increasing their positions, 52 reducing their positions, and 28 closing their positions.
